## Summary
The Research and Data Centre (WODC) is a government organization and research institute located in The Hague, Netherlands. It operates under the parent organization of the Ministry of Justice and Security. The institute is recognized internationally through various identifiers, including GRID, ISNI, and ROR.

## FAQs
### Q: What does the acronym WODC stand for?
A: WODC is the alias for the Research and Data Centre. The associated Wikimedia commons category lists the full Dutch name as *Wetenschappelijk Onderzoek- en Documentatiecentrum*.

### Q: Is the Research and Data Centre part of the Dutch government?
A: Yes, it is classified as a government organization and its parent organization is the Ministry of Justice and Security.

### Q: Where is the Research and Data Centre located?
A: The centre is located in The Hague, Netherlands.

## Why It Matters
The Research and Data Centre (WODC) serves as a vital link between scientific research and government policy within the Netherlands. As the research arm of the Ministry of Justice and Security, it plays a critical role in generating data and analysis that inform justice and security policies. By functioning as a specialized research institute within a government framework, the WODC ensures that legislative and operational decisions are supported by empirical evidence.
